    Our team has multiple job titles/roles for candidates with eligible Master's Degrees to choose from...

    • Intensive Behavioral Intervention Specialist: An Intensive Behavioral Intervention Specialist is responsible for providing direct behavior management consultation services to clients, staff members, and family members. These services include client observation, the development and documentation of specific behavior management plans, direct intervention with clients, education and training for staff, and service coordination, among others.

    • Outpatient Counselor: An Outpatient Counselor is responsible for a variety of duties related to case development, treatment plan development and implementation, and crisis intervention in individual treatment of clients. The incumbent is responsible for providing individual and family therapy, group support, crisis intervention, as well as other support services to assigned clients. Additionally, Outpatient Counselor will assists the treatment team, including the Director of Intensive Behavioral Intervention Services, Stabilization and Treatment team, Outpatient team, and other members as designated, in the evaluation of clinical services.

    • Behavior Consultant: A Behavior Consultant is responsible for providing direct behavior management consultation services to clients, staff members, and family members. These services include client observation, the development and documentation of specific behavior management plans, direct intervention with clients, education and training for staff, crisis intervention, and service coordination, among others.
